Steam expansion for non-Steam game

Yes, it will give issues.
Even if you are able to buy DLC through Steam of a base game you don't own on the platform - which is likely impossible - installing it properly would be difficult and cumbersome, if at all viable (different files, different structures, different registry entries, &c.).

The game is currently on sale on Steam, though (75% off).